uPVC

uPVC offers a cost-effective and energy-efficient solution for both business and homes. It also offers a variety of advantages like increased security and sound insulation. In contrast to other materials, uPVC has a long lifespan and is impervious to weather and pollution. It doesn't corrode and doesn't require staining or painting. Furthermore, it's eco-friendly and recyclable.

UPVC is available in a range of colors and finishes, including wood-effect frames.

One of the biggest benefits of uPVC is that it is extremely durable, which makes it a great option for doors and windows. It is resistant to UV radiation, rot and corrosion. It is able to withstand harsh weather conditions. It is also low maintenance, requiring only periodic cleaning to keep it looking fresh.

Another benefit of uPVC is its thermal efficiency. Its insulation properties can cut down on heating bills by preventing heat losses during winter, and also by reducing the cost of air conditioning in summer. It can also reduce noise pollution, making it a good alternative for homes and apartments in urban areas.

It also is resistant to fire and chemicals. This makes uPVC more secure than other building materials, such as timber and aluminum. It is also able to withstand strong storms and heavy rainfall and is a fantastic feature for homeowners who live in coastal areas or have high-rise buildings.

UPVC can also be recycled to make new products. It's a cost-effective and sustainable alternative to other materials like aluminium or timber. It also doesn't have to be painted or stained which means it will last for years without losing its look or functionality.

UPVC comes in various styles and designs, including casements, tilt-and-turn bays and tilt-and-turn. UPVC can also be custom-designed to suit your preferences and your home's needs. Double glazing is a popular choice for homeowners looking to increase the efficiency of their homes. It is harder for cold air than windows with a single pane to penetrate your home. This helps reduce energy costs and helps keep your home at a an ideal temperature. It can also help to protect your furniture from damage by blocking the excess heat and sun, especially in summer. Furthermore, double-glazed windows are more effective at making noise less disruptive than single-pane windows.

The space between two double-glazed panes collects air and forms a layer of insulation. This can help prevent cold air from entering your home and warm air from escaping and thereby reducing your energy bills. The insulation and glass can also reduce the frequency of sound waves. This is a huge benefit for homeowners who live near airports, freeways and busy highways.

Another benefit of double glazing is that it can help reduce condensation on your windows. Air is made up of tiny droplets of water that are not visible to our naked eyes. These tiny droplets of water are usually separated, but when they contact the cooler surface, like a windowpane they clump and form visible drops. The condensation can lead to mould and mildew and even cause rot to your window frame.

Double-glazed windows reduce condensation by using inner glass which is warmer than the outer glass. This will save you money on cleaning costs, and also protect your furniture from damage caused by humidity and mold.

Security

Sliding sash windows come with numerous impressive features to protect your home from unwanted intruders. There is a security bar to stop intruders from using tools or force to open windows, and travel restrictors to restrict the opening to 100mm. These features will let you rest peacefully knowing that your home is protected from intruders. They also increase your home's thermal efficiency and help you save money on energy bills and reduce carbon footprint. This is especially important during the winter months when you'll need to rely on heating to stay warm.
